As the peace process advances in Colombia President Juan Manuel Santos, government officials and representatives of the Common Alternative Revolutionary Force party, FARC, met Thursday in Cartagena to review the implementation of the final peace treaty signed November 2016.
Among the external verifiers of the treatys implementation were Jose Mujica, former president of Uruguay, and Felipe Gonzalez, the former Spanish president.
During a speech after the review meeting, Mujica called on Colombians to embrace peace and stressed the importance of this process not only for Colombia but for the entire region. "If this fails, Latin American history fails."
He then went on to criticize the voices against the peace process saying that those who do not know and measure the long-term cost of war do not value peace, adding that you cannot ask people to give up arms then put them in jail for 30 years.

If Peace in Colombia Fails, Latin America will Fail, Mujica Says
Cartagena, Colombia, Jan 5 (Prensa Latina) Former Uruguayan President Jose Mujica noted at a meeting to review Colombia''s Peace Agreement that the cost of tolerance is infinitively lower than the cost of war.
'This cannot roll back. If this peace process in Colombia fails, Latin America will fail,' noted the ex-head of State, who attended a government-FARC meeting in this city on Thursday, along with former Spanish President Felipe Gonzalez.
'We have to learn to tolerate, to live with difference,' stressed Mujica, who pointed out that it is time for reconciliation.
'I wish with all my heart that the ghost of war does not walk the streets, the hills, the mountain ranges, the forests of Latin America,' he said at the end of the meeting, at which the Alternative Revolutionary Force of the Common (FARC) party expressed concern about the difficult time the peace process is going through.
